NoiseFit Pro 6R was introduced in India by the technology company on Tuesday as the newest entry in its smartwatch collection. It is now available for purchase on several online shopping sites and the company's official site. This smartwatch comes with options for a Leather Strap, Silicone Strap, and Metal Strap, each available in different colors. The latest NoiseFit Pro 6R features a 42mm round face, which includes a 1.46-inch AMOLED screen. This smartwatch works with both Android and iOS mobile phones. The company claims that the NoiseFit Pro 6R can last for up to seven days on a single charge. The starting price of the NoiseFit Pro 6R in India is Rs. 6,999 for the leather and silicone strap versions. The model with the metal strap costs Rs. 7,999. Currently, this new smartwatch can be bought in India through Amazon, Flipkart, and the official Noise India online store. The leather strap version comes in both Brown and Black colors. The metal strap variant is available in Titanium and Chrome Black, while the silicone strap model comes in Black and Starlight Gold.
The NoiseFit Pro 6R includes several health monitoring features, such as tracking heart rate, blood-oxygen levels, and stress. It will also provide a score based on the quality of a user's sleep. Additionally, it tracks recovery and readiness for exercise by monitoring various health indicators to offer a Readiness score. This smartwatch also includes menstrual cycle tracking. With a 1.46-inch AMOLED display, it can reach a maximum brightness of 1,000 nits. The NoiseFit Pro 6R is also designed with a 42mm round dial. It has an IP68 rating, meaning it is resistant to dust and water. The company also states that the smartwatch can handle water exposure up to 100m deep. On the right side, it features a crown and a button for navigation.
This smartwatch is compatible with both iOS and Android gadgets. According to the claims, the NoiseFit Pro 6R can provide up to seven days of battery life with normal use and up to 30 days when in standby mode. It can go from completely empty to fully charged in around two hours, as stated by the company. It comes with built-in GPS that integrates with Strava. Additionally, the device supports Noise AI Pro, which will provide health insights, control for devices, and the ability to create AI-generated watch faces.
